:: Send Message

To send a message to other chat room users, type your message in the message box as shown above and click the 'Send' button.
|
:: Smilies/Emoticons

This feature allows you to add smilies/emoticons to your chat messages. To add a smilie/emoticon to your message, click the smilie/emoticon button and a window will appear with a preset selection of smilies/emoticons. Click the smilie/emoticon you would like to add to your message. |
:: Avatars

This feature allows you to display an avatar next to your name and chat messages. To choose an avatar, click the avatar button and a window will appear with a preset selection of avatars. Click the avatar you would like to use. |
:: Share Files*

This feature allows you share photos/images with other chat room users. To share your image, click the share button and a window will appear prompting you to upload your image. You can share your image with all users or privately during conversations.

:: Private Chat

To send private messages, enter the username of the user you wish to chat privately with in the box as shown in the picture above. Then type your message and press 'Send'.
You can also start a private conversation by clicking a username in the userlist and select the option to 'Private Chat'. This will open a new private chat window. |
:: Create a Room*

To add your own room, click on the house icon above the user list. Enter your room name in the field provided and click 'Create Room'.
To password protect a room, type your desider password into the provided field at room creation. Any user trying to enter the room will now need to enter a password first.

:: IRC Type Commands
1) /roll ndn
In the message bar, type '/roll ndn' (without the quotes). This command allows you to simulate rolling dice in the chat room. For example, type '/roll 3d3' to auto-generate a number between 3 and 9.
Additionall, you may include a postive or negative modifier by typing ''/roll ndn (+/-)n' (without the quotes). For example, type '/roll 3d3 -3' to auto-generate a number between 0 and 6.
2) /me message
In the message bar, type '/me message' (without the quotes). This command allows you to add fun action messages. Example: Type '/me files around the room' (without the quotes) and a message will appear in the main chat window informing other users that 'username flies around the room'.
3) /broadcast message (admins only)
In the message bar, type '/broadcast message' (without the quotes). This command allows you to send announcements to all chat users in every chat room (these will be displayed both on screen and by pop up notifications).
4) /ringbell
In the message bar, type '/ringbell' (without the quotes). This command intitiates the bell sfx to the chat room.
5) /play name of sound
In the message bar, type '/play name of sound' (without the quotes). This command intitiates a sound SFX. For example, '/play boo' will play boo.mp3 sound in the chat room.
